From: Anirudh Ghayal <redacted>

VBUS can be detected via a dedicated PMIC pin. Add support
for reporting the VBUS status.

Signed-off-by: Anirudh Ghayal <redacted>
Signed-off-by: Kavya Nunna <redacted>
Signed-off-by: Guru Das Srinagesh <redacted>
---
  drivers/extcon/extcon-qcom-spmi-misc.c | 99 +++++++++++++++++++++++++++-------
  1 file changed, 80 insertions(+), 19 deletions(-)
diff --git a/drivers/extcon/extcon-qcom-spmi-misc.c b/drivers/extcon/extcon-qcom-spmi-misc.c
index 6b836ae..9e8ccfb 100644
--- a/drivers/extcon/extcon-qcom-spmi-misc.c
+++ b/drivers/extcon/extcon-qcom-spmi-misc.c
@@ -1,7 +1,7 @@
  // SPDX-License-Identifier: GPL-2.0-only
  /**
   * extcon-qcom-spmi-misc.c - Qualcomm USB extcon driver to support USB ID
- *				detection based on extcon-usb-gpio.c.
+ *			and VBUS detection based on extcon-usb-gpio.c.
   *
   * Copyright (C) 2016 Linaro, Ltd.
   * Stephen Boyd <stephen.boyd@linaro.org>
@@ -21,30 +21,56 @@
  
  struct qcom_usb_extcon_info {
  	struct extcon_dev *edev;
-	int irq;
+	int id_irq;
+	int vbus_irq;
  	struct delayed_work wq_detcable;
  	unsigned long debounce_jiffies;
  };
  
  static const unsigned int qcom_usb_extcon_cable[] = {
+	EXTCON_USB,
  	EXTCON_USB_HOST,
  	EXTCON_NONE,
  };
  
  static void qcom_usb_extcon_detect_cable(struct work_struct *work)
  {
-	bool id;
+	bool state = false;
  	int ret;
+	union extcon_property_value val;
  	struct qcom_usb_extcon_info *info = container_of(to_delayed_work(work),
  						    struct qcom_usb_extcon_info,
  						    wq_detcable);
  
-	/* check ID and update cable state */
-	ret = irq_get_irqchip_state(info->irq, IRQCHIP_STATE_LINE_LEVEL, &id);
-	if (ret)
-		return;
+	if (info->id_irq > 0) {
+		/* check ID and update cable state */
+		ret = irq_get_irqchip_state(info->id_irq,
+				IRQCHIP_STATE_LINE_LEVEL, &state);
+		if (ret)
+			return;
+
+		if (!state) {
+			val.intval = true;
+			extcon_set_property(info->edev, EXTCON_USB_HOST,
+						EXTCON_PROP_USB_SS, val);
+		}
+		extcon_set_state_sync(info->edev, EXTCON_USB_HOST, !state);
+	}
  
-	extcon_set_state_sync(info->edev, EXTCON_USB_HOST, !id);
+	if (info->vbus_irq > 0) {
+		/* check VBUS and update cable state */
+		ret = irq_get_irqchip_state(info->vbus_irq,
+				IRQCHIP_STATE_LINE_LEVEL, &state);
+		if (ret)
+			return;
+
+		if (state) {
+			val.intval = true;
+			extcon_set_property(info->edev, EXTCON_USB,
+						EXTCON_PROP_USB_SS, val);
+		}
+		extcon_set_state_sync(info->edev, EXTCON_USB, state);
+	}
  }
  
  static irqreturn_t qcom_usb_irq_handler(int irq, void *dev_id)
@@ -79,21 +105,48 @@ static int qcom_usb_extcon_probe(struct platform_device *pdev)
  		return ret;
  	}
  
+	ret = extcon_set_property_capability(info->edev,
+			EXTCON_USB, EXTCON_PROP_USB_SS);
+	ret |= extcon_set_property_capability(info->edev,
+			EXTCON_USB_HOST, EXTCON_PROP_USB_SS);
+	if (ret) {
+		dev_err(dev, "failed to register extcon props rc=%d\n",
+						ret);
+		return ret;
+	}
+
  	info->debounce_jiffies = msecs_to_jiffies(USB_ID_DEBOUNCE_MS);
  	INIT_DELAYED_WORK(&info->wq_detcable, qcom_usb_extcon_detect_cable);
  
-	info->irq = platform_get_irq_byname(pdev, "usb_id");
-	if (info->irq < 0)
-		return info->irq;
+	info->id_irq = platform_get_irq_byname(pdev, "usb_id");
+	if (info->id_irq > 0) {
+		ret = devm_request_threaded_irq(dev, info->id_irq, NULL,
+					qcom_usb_irq_handler,
+					IRQF_TRIGGER_RISING |
+					IRQF_TRIGGER_FALLING | IRQF_ONESHOT,
+					pdev->name, info);
+		if (ret < 0) {
+			dev_err(dev, "failed to request handler for ID IRQ\n");
+			return ret;
+		}
+	}
  
-	ret = devm_request_threaded_irq(dev, info->irq, NULL,
+	info->vbus_irq = platform_get_irq_byname(pdev, "usb_vbus");
+	if (info->vbus_irq > 0) {
+		ret = devm_request_threaded_irq(dev, info->vbus_irq, NULL,
  					qcom_usb_irq_handler,
  					IRQF_TRIGGER_RISING |
  					IRQF_TRIGGER_FALLING | IRQF_ONESHOT,
  					pdev->name, info);
-	if (ret < 0) {
-		dev_err(dev, "failed to request handler for ID IRQ\n");
-		return ret;
+		if (ret < 0) {
+			dev_err(dev, "failed to request handler for VBUS IRQ\n");
+			return ret;
+		}
+	}
+
+	if (info->id_irq < 0 && info->vbus_irq < 0) {
+		dev_err(dev, "ID and VBUS IRQ not found\n");
+		return -EINVAL;
  	}
  
  	platform_set_drvdata(pdev, info);
@@ -120,8 +173,12 @@ static int qcom_usb_extcon_suspend(struct device *dev)
  	struct qcom_usb_extcon_info *info = dev_get_drvdata(dev);
  	int ret = 0;
  
-	if (device_may_wakeup(dev))
-		ret = enable_irq_wake(info->irq);
+	if (device_may_wakeup(dev)) {
+		if (info->id_irq > 0)
+			ret = enable_irq_wake(info->id_irq);
+		if (info->vbus_irq > 0)
+			ret = enable_irq_wake(info->vbus_irq);
+	}
  
  	return ret;
  }
@@ -131,8 +188,12 @@ static int qcom_usb_extcon_resume(struct device *dev)
  	struct qcom_usb_extcon_info *info = dev_get_drvdata(dev);
  	int ret = 0;
  
-	if (device_may_wakeup(dev))
-		ret = disable_irq_wake(info->irq);
+	if (device_may_wakeup(dev)) {
+		if (info->id_irq > 0)
+			ret = disable_irq_wake(info->id_irq);
+		if (info->vbus_irq > 0)
+			ret = disable_irq_wake(info->vbus_irq);
+	}
  
  	return ret;
  }
